Summary of Movie Control Panel

The following operations are available on the movie control panel

accessed as described in “Viewing” (= 101).

Exit
Play
Slow Motion (Press the [ ][ ] buttons to adjust the playback

speed. No sound is played.)
Skip Backward* or Previous Clip (= 121) (To continue skipping

backward, keep holding down the [ ] button.)
Previous Frame (For fast-rewind, keep holding down the [ ]

button.)
Next Frame (For fast-forward, keep holding down the [ ] button.)
Skip Forward* or Next Clip (= 121) (To continue skipping

forward, keep holding down the [ ] button.)
Edit (= 120)
Erase Clip (displayed when a digest movie is selected (= 121))
Shown when the camera is connected to a PictBridge-compatible

printer (= 166).

* Displays the frame approx. 4 sec. before or after the current frame.

During movie playback, you can skip back or forward (or to the
previous or next clip) by pressing the [ ][ ] buttons.
